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18 8772 8916647720 3200
23 1107
23 1107
6944 432525 86 4746786 8743
All about undefined
Interested in learning more?
23 1107
6944 432525 86 4746786 8743
See more
508836707 0412411989 528
055 73223930848 35
See more
646478 8258636 849180
08595 371691 00783386
See more